Management Meeting Minutes — Larkspur Launch Plan

Attendees: heads of department; chaired by Priya Venn.

We locked the Larkspur handheld launch for early spring. Marketing wants teaser material ready six weeks out; ops confirmed the Calder Bay line can hit volume by then. Pricing is still being argued over — Tomas will circulate options Thursday. Support training starts next month. One sensitive item came up at the end, and it's recorded just below.

internal memo for tadup-hahag: Project Feniel slips by six weeks because of the audit delay.

## Further Reading

If you're on call and GateKeeper just blocked (or worse, passed) a canary you didn't expect, don't panic — the gating rules are deterministic, just not obvious. Error-rate and latency thresholds are evaluated per region, and a single bad region vetoes the whole rollout. Before overriding anything, read the full rule definitions and override etiquette, which we keep up to date on the internal page here.

dashboard of tawef-hagug = https://superset.norvadyn.local/display/projects/build/ticket/build/spaces/ticket/1e989f0e6c200d20fc4ae06b

## Environment Variables — Hueproof Audit Runner

Hueproof scans staged pages for WCAG contrast failures on every merge. Set `HUEPROOF_THRESHOLD=4.5` for body text and `SCAN_DEPTH=2` to follow internal links. Results post back to the Tintboard dashboard, which requires an API credential; the runner reads it from the env file on this line.

secret setting of yajog-taguf: ARCHIVE_KEY3=051

## Runbook: Account Recovery — Printweld Spooler

If the Printweld spooler's service account is locked out (usually after three failed token rotations), do not recreate the account — queued jobs reference its identity. Instead, follow the recovery flow: pause the ingest queue, verify no render jobs are mid-flight, then open the sealed recovery console from the bastion host.

The console will prompt once; enter the recovery passphrase exactly as written below.

unlock words, yawig-kagef: gordor-holvan-ulaael-pramir-ulaiel-tamdor